How much do complete family dentistry j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for complete family dentistry in Decatur, GA is $22.58,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.99 and $24.18 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Complete Family Dentistry provides comprehensive dental services for patients of all ages, focusing on general oral health. Pediatric Dentists specialize in dental care for children, with additional training in child psychology and behavior management. While both roles aim to promote oral health, Complete Family Dentists handle a broader age range, whereas Pediatric Dentists focus exclusively on children.

Job description

Overview
We are a family dentistry practice looking for an experienced, Practice Manager to be part of our team. The Practice Manager is responsible for the day-to-day functions of the dental office, as well as the management of staff members. Must have strong leadership abilities to help guide the growth and success of our practice. Must lead by example with compassion, have a high-level work ethic and extensive knowledge of dentistry.
Must be highly competent in managing all business aspects of a dental office. We are looking for someone who can lead our team and help us grow and fulfill the vision for the practice. Our focus is providing excellent service to our patients.

PRINCIPA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Lead by example and coach team to provide exceptional patient experiences
  • Create, establish and manage internal office protocols and procedures to ensure office efficiency
  • Evaluate and review office production and procedures to develop new ways to improve efficiency with office operations, patient retention, and profitability
  • Oversee timely processing of insurance claims
  • Oversee collections and accounts receivable
  • Schedule team members to ensure adequate shift coverage and facilitate requests for time off
  • Serve as opening/closing manager
  • Assist in the interviewing, on-boarding and training of new hires
  • Communicate with office team regularly to ensure they have the information, tools, and support needed to perform their jobs effectively and successfully
  • Lead staff trainings
  • Complete administrative tasks, such as bank deposits, revenue posting payroll and invoice processing
  • Ensure execution of operational standards, including compliance with the office policies, procedures, and government regulations
  • Organize and oversee supply purchases and operations expenses
  • Take responsibility for the appearance and functionality of the office
  • Ensure maintenance of records in compliance with privacy and security regulations and maintain facilities and equipment in accordance with OSHA standards
  • Oversee infection control program to ensure compliance with policies and procedures including staff training, data collection, maintenance of logs and documentation
  • Other duties as required

QUALIFICATIONS:
  • High School Diploma or equivalent required. Additional education in Health Care
    Administration preferred
  • 2 years of dental office management or supervisory experience required
  • Compassionate, friendly and caring individual
  • Prior experience with dental management software - Eaglesoft preferred
  • Strong knowledge of dental billing and insurance protocols
  • Knowledge of dental terminology, procedures and diagnosis

KEY COMPETENCIES
  • Excellent customer service and leadership skills
  • Ability to plan and prioritize duties
  • Confidentiality
  • Strong organizational skills
  • Proficient computer skills (i.e. Windows, Microsoft Office Suite)

Who We Are
Smile America Partners is the nation's leading in-school dental program founded almost two decades ago by two moms, who happen to also be dentists. The founders saw a tremendous need among underserved school aged children who did not have easy access to dental care and who often suffered from poor oral hygiene, tooth decay, pain and associated medical problems. Knowing that many parents could not take their children to the dentist due to issues including time off from work and transportation challenges, they sought to bring the care to the need. Today, through its dental partners, Smile America Partners provides preventive and restorative care to approximately 500,000 children per year.
Tooth decay is the most common, and preventable disease among children, more common than asthma. In fact, each year, over 51 million school hours are lost due to oral health related issues.
Smile America Partners affiliates with state licensed dentists, hygienists and assistants who use state-of-the-art portable equipment to provide all services onsite, directly in the school or in a self-contained mobile dental facility on site at the school. If portable equipment is used, classrooms, auditoriums or other school venues are literally transformed into fully functional dental offices for the day. Our expertise, obtained through years of experience bringing mobile dental care to schools, as well as through our highly qualified staff, enables us to bring exceptional care with minimal disruption to the normal school routine.
Smile America Partners is currently active in 20 states and has ongoing strategic partnerships with over 8,000 school districts, including 21 of the 25 largest school districts in the country.
